États-Unis : démarrage de la production du champ offshore de Ballymore

PARIS--(BUSINESS WIRE)--TotalEnergies annonce le démarrage de la production du champ de Ballymore en offshore profond au large des Etats-Unis, dans lequel la Compagnie détient une participation de 40 % aux côtés de l’opérateur Chevron (60 %). Situé à 120 kilomètres des côtes de la Louisiane, le champ de Ballymore, dont le développement a été approuvé en mai 2022, présente une capacité de production brute de 75 000 barils de pétrole et de 50 millions de pieds cubes de gaz par jour.
